Online information utility assessment for per-device adaptive test flow

Per-device adaptive test is a promising direction with the best trade-off between test quality and test time so far. In this work, we propose a method for online assessment of the information content of the next test in the test queue. This assessment can be used to tune the trade-off between test quality and test time of a per-device adaptive test. Since majority of specification parameters are correlated, the overall information content of multiple tests is difficult to extract. We model multi-variate correlations among specification parameters and take these correlations into account to estimate the multivariate overall information utility of a given set of tests. The proposed method can be integrated within an existing adaptive test flow (per-device or per-wafer) that runs in the background. Experimental results using 3 distinct industry circuits and sizable data show that the proposed technique can finely tune the trade-off, even achieve zero test escape rates with appreciable test time savings.

[1]  R. D. Blanton,et al.  Statistical Test Compaction Using Binary Decision Trees , 2006, IEEE Design & Test of Computers.

[2]  Carlo Tomasi,et al.  Singular Value Decomposition , 2021, Encyclopedia of Social Network Analysis and Mining.

[3]  Ke Huang,et al.  Test-Suite-Based Analog/RF Test Time Reduction Using Canonical Correlation , 2016, I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ems.

[4]  Christian Streitwieser Real-time adaptive test algorithm including test escape estimation method , 2015 .

[5]  Kenneth M. Butler,et al.  Adaptive test flow for mixed-signal/RF circuits using learned information from device under test , 2010, 2010 IEEE International Test Conference.

[6]  Haralampos-G. D. Stratigopoulos,et al.  Adaptive test flow for mixed-signal ICs , 2017, 2017 IEEE 35th VLSI Test Symposium (VTS).

[7]  Mingjing Chen,et al.  Test cost minimization through adaptive test development , 2008, 2008 IEEE International Conference on Computer Design.

[8]  Scott Benner,et al.  Optimal production test times through adaptive test programming , 2001, Proceedings International Test Conference 2001 (Cat. No.01CH37260).

[9]  R. D. Blanton,et al.  Test Compaction for Mixed-Signal Circuits Using Pass-Fail Test Data , 2008, 26th IEEE VLSI Test Symposium (vts 2008).

[10]  Abhijit Chatterjee,et al.  Alternate Test of RF Front Ends with IP Constraints: Frequency Domain Test Generation and Validation , 2006, 2006 IEEE International Test Conference.

[11]  Raffaele Persico The Singular Value Decomposition , 2014 .

[12]  Yiorgos Makris,et al.  On Boosting the Accuracy of Non-RF to RF Correlation-Based Specification Test Compaction , 2009, J. Electron. Test..

[13]  Yiorgos Makris,et al.  Wafer-level process variation-driven probe-test flow selection for test cost reduction in analog/RF ICs , 2016, 2016 IEEE 34th VLSI Test Symposium (VTS).

[14]  Kenneth M. Butler,et al.  Per-Device Adaptive Test for Analog/RF Circuits Using Entropy-Based Process Monitoring , 2013, IEEE Transactions on Very Large Scale Integration (VLSI) Systems.

[15]  Yiorgos Makris,et al.  Non-RF to RF Test Correlation Using Learning Machines: A Case Study , 2007, 25th IEEE VLSI Test Symposium (VTS'07).

[16]  Yiorgos Makris,et al.  Independent test sequence compaction through integer programming , 2003, Proceedings 21st International Conference on Computer Design.

[17]  Kenneth M. Butler,et al.  Adaptive multidimensional outlier analysis for analog and mixed signal circuits , 2011, 2011 IEEE International Test Conference.

[18]  Sule Ozev,et al.  Adaptive test elimination for analog/RF circuits , 2009, 2009 46th ACM/IEEE Design Automation Conference.

[19]  Thomas M. Cover,et al.  Elements of information theory (2. ed.) , 2006 .